When I was born, a fence was built around me. 'You can only think up to here, and go up to here. Beyond that you won't be safe'.
'These are our idols. Choose any one of them, and you'll be happy. We will esteem you'.
The girls, the toys. The dancing and the laughter: fashion and trends.
'The sky is the limit'. That's the furthest we can see.
And when you feel so bad about yourself, you can have some brandy to warm you up. Get giddy and stagger and fall. And blame it all on the brandy.
Or you can wank yourself dry. The bitches are too slippery.
When you die, there'll definitely be an elegy. You won't lack a send off.
'Then beyond the fence you shall be judged according to what you did and said from from within'.
Oh. The chains on my neck, wrists and legs!
Even my fart is part of the fence!
Shame. Crying and gnashing of teeth. Where's Lazarus to quench my burning? I hope he remembers, all the bones I threw him.
